National Truck Driver Appreciation Week 2020: Echo Recognizes Truck Drivers This Week and Beyond

In honor of National Truck Driver Appreciation Week, September 13–19, all of us here at Echo would like to express our gratitude to every truck driver across the nation. We commend you for the hard work you do every day as you take on one of the most demanding and important jobs in America. We’re thankful for your dedication to delivering freight and ensuring we all have the goods we need for our daily lives.
This year’s National Truck Driver Appreciation Week takes on a special significance considering the vital role truck drivers have played throughout the COVID-19 pandemic. Your courage and commitment have allowed all of us to get the essential items we need, both as individuals and businesses. To show our gratitude to truck drivers, earlier this year we launched EchoCares: Thanking Truck Drivers During COVID-19. Through this initiative, we surprised over 2,200 truck drivers from across the country with Subway® gift cards as a small way to show our appreciation. As the effects of COVID-19 continue to impact the country, we cannot thank you enough for all that you’re doing to keep America moving during these challenging times.
